My question was, I’ve been making butter/oil for dosing and I’m trying to get the correct butter to “flower” ratio.

I think that this is a matter of preference depending on tolerance, but I just wanted to ask for your input.

Doing it like this is not a science so I’m trying to see what you guys do. Myself, 3grams of keif for each 1/2 cup stick of butter that is sifted through the 120 screen.

I made a batch of 32 cookies with 3 grams of Keif (decarbed). The cookies are all equal weight and size, and then I cut then in quarters giving me 128 doses of nice mellow highs.

I’m shifting to using bud now. Would like to see how much bud you use per stick of butter?
